告别模拟器!在Windows上轻松安装安卓应用的秘密武器
【免费下载链接】APK-InstallerAn Android Application Installer for Windows项目地址: https://gitcode.com/GitHub_Trending/ap/APK-Installer
还在为Windows上安装安卓应用而烦恼吗?想象一下,你下载了一个有趣的安卓游戏,想在电脑上畅玩,却发现需要安装庞大的安卓模拟器,等待漫长的启动时间,还要配置复杂的参数。有没有更简单的方法?今天我要向你介绍一款神奇的工具——APK安装器,它彻底改变了Windows平台安装安卓应用的游戏规则。
🎯 你的痛点,它都懂
你是不是经常遇到这些问题:
- 模拟器太重:动辄几个GB的安装包,占用大量磁盘空间
- 启动太慢:每次使用都要等待几分钟的启动时间
- 配置复杂:需要调整CPU、内存、分辨率等各种参数
- 兼容性差:某些应用在模拟器上运行卡顿甚至崩溃
别担心,APK安装器正是为了解决这些问题而生。它采用轻量级设计,无需虚拟化整个安卓系统,直接解析APK文件并在Windows上安装,让你用最简单的方式享受安卓应用。
🔍 APK安装器 vs 传统模拟器:谁才是赢家?
| 对比维度 | 传统安卓模拟器 | APK安装器 |
|---|---|---|
| 安装大小 | 通常2GB以上 | 仅需400MB空间 |
| 启动速度 | 1-3分钟 | 几秒钟 |
| 资源占用 | 高(虚拟化整个系统) | 极低(仅解析APK) |
| 使用难度 | 需要技术知识 | 一键安装,傻瓜式操作 |
| 系统要求 | 要求高配置硬件 | Windows 10 Build 17763及以上 |
看到区别了吗?APK安装器就像一把瑞士军刀,小巧却功能强大,专为解决特定问题而设计。
🚀 三步搞定:你的第一个安卓应用安装指南
第一步:获取APK安装器
你可以从Microsoft Store直接下载安装,或者从GitCode克隆源码自己编译:
git clone https://gitcode.com/GitHub_Trending/ap/APK-Installer第二步:准备你的APK文件
找到你想要安装的安卓应用APK文件。可以是游戏、工具应用,或者任何你喜欢的安卓软件。
第三步:开始安装之旅
- 右键点击APK文件,选择"用APK安装器打开"
- 查看应用信息:在安装确认界面,你可以看到应用的详细信息
这个界面展示了应用的关键信息:发布者、版本号,以及最重要的——应用需要的权限。比如上图显示"酷安UWP"应用需要网络访问权限,让你在安装前就清楚知道应用会做什么。
- 审查权限:点击安装前,仔细查看应用需要的所有权限
看,这是《我的世界》的安装界面!它不仅显示了包名和版本,还列出了详细的能力权限:网络访问、应用内购、许可证检查等。点击"More"还可以查看更多权限,真正做到透明安装。
- 确认安装:点击蓝色安装按钮,等待进度完成
- 应用自动启动:如果勾选了"当准备就绪时启动",应用安装完成后会自动运行
🔒 安全第一:为什么APK安装器值得信赖?
双重安全机制
APK安装器内置了严格的安全检查:
- 证书验证:检查APK文件的数字签名,确保来源可信
- 权限审查:详细解析AndroidManifest.xml中的权限声明
- 系统级保护:Windows的安全机制会拦截可疑操作
当网页尝试调用APK安装器时,Windows会弹出安全提示,让你确认是否允许。这种系统级的安全机制,确保了你对安装过程的完全控制。
权限分类,一目了然
APK安装器将权限分为不同级别,帮助你做出明智决策:
| 权限类型 | 安全级别 | 说明 |
|---|---|---|
| INTERNET | 中等 | 网络访问权限,大多数应用都需要 |
| CAMERA | 高 | 摄像头访问,涉及隐私 |
| LOCATION | 高 | 位置信息,敏感权限 |
| BILLING | 高 | 应用内购买,涉及支付 |
| CHECK_LICENSE | 中等 | 许可证验证,一般安全 |
🌍 全球化体验:30+语言支持
APK安装器支持超过30种语言,无论你来自哪个国家,都能获得本地化的使用体验。项目中的APKInstaller/Strings/目录包含了各种语言的资源文件,确保全球用户都能无障碍使用。
🛠️ 高级技巧:让安装更高效
批量安装技巧
如果你需要安装多个APK文件,可以创建简单的批处理脚本:
# 将以下内容保存为install_all.ps1 $apkFiles = Get-ChildItem "C:\我的APK\*.apk" foreach ($apk in $apkFiles) { Start-Process "APKInstaller.exe" -ArgumentList $apk.FullName Start-Sleep -Seconds 3 }开发者专用:命令行安装
如果你是开发者,APK安装器提供了命令行支持:
# 静默安装模式 APKInstaller.exe /silent myapp.apk # 指定安装目录 APKInstaller.exe /target:"D:\AndroidApps" app.apk # 批量安装 APKInstaller.exe app1.apk app2.apk app3.apk🔧 常见问题速查手册
| 问题 | 原因 | 解决方案 |
|---|---|---|
| 安装失败,提示证书错误 | 开发者证书未正确导入 | 重新导入证书到"受信任的根证书颁发机构" |
| 应用安装后无法启动 | 架构不兼容 | 检查APK支持的ABI架构,确保与系统匹配 |
| 权限请求被系统拒绝 | Windows权限限制 | 在Windows设置中手动启用相关权限 |
| 网页安装链接无效 | 浏览器安全限制 | 下载APK到本地后再安装 |
🏗️ 技术揭秘:APK安装器如何工作?
APK安装器的核心由几个关键模块组成:
- 解析层:位于
AAPTForNet/目录,负责解析APK文件结构 - 权限过滤器:在
AAPTForNet/Filters/中,分析应用需要的所有权限 - 网络模块:使用Zeroconf实现设备间自动发现
- 用户界面:现代化的Windows UI设计,支持多语言
这种模块化设计让APK安装器既轻量又强大,每个部分都专注于解决特定问题。
🚀 未来展望:APK安装器的进化之路
APK安装器正在不断进化,未来的版本将带来更多惊喜:
- 性能优化:利用Windows Subsystem for Android的底层能力
- 功能扩展:支持APK签名验证、应用更新管理
- 开发者工具:集成APK分析、调试功能
- 云服务集成:直接从应用商店安装应用
🤝 加入社区:一起让工具更好用
APK安装器是开源项目,任何人都可以参与改进:
- UI优化:修改
APKInstaller/Controls/中的控件 - 解析逻辑:优化
AAPTForNet/Filters/中的过滤器 - 多语言支持:贡献新的语言翻译到
Strings/目录 - 文档完善:帮助改进安装指南和使用说明
代码阅读建议
如果你想深入了解APK安装器的工作原理:
- 从
InstallViewModel.cs开始:了解安装流程的核心逻辑 - 查看
ApkParser.cs:学习APK文件解析的具体实现 - 研究
PermissionFilter.cs:理解权限处理的内部机制
🎉 现在就开始你的Windows安卓之旅吧!
APK安装器已经为你铺平了道路。无论你是想:
- ✅在Windows上玩安卓游戏:无需模拟器,直接安装运行
- ✅测试开发的应用:快速安装测试,提高开发效率
- ✅管理多个APK文件:批量安装,节省时间
- ✅安全审查应用权限:安装前了解应用的所有权限
这款工具都能完美胜任。它轻量、快速、安全,而且完全免费开源。
立即尝试APK安装器,体验Windows上安装安卓应用的全新方式!告别笨重的模拟器,迎接高效便捷的新时代。
【免费下载链接】APK-InstallerAn Android Application Installer for Windows项目地址: https://gitcode.com/GitHub_Trending/ap/APK-Installer
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考